Manager overseeing electric distribution operations and maintenance teams ensuring compliance and service delivery at PG&E. Leading outage response and system restoration efforts while maintaining safety standards.
Responsibilities
Manages teams involved in maintaining or building parts, command & control outage response, and monitoring and restoration efforts of the system-wide service territory distribution grid.
Provides safe and reliable electric service while maintaining compliance with the California Public Utility Commission (CPUC) General Orders, and all procedures and safety regulations and other regulatory requirements.
Analyze and prioritize outages to determine most efficient restoration needs.
Implements safety policies and best practices and manages employee accountability.
Ensures full compliance with the Injury & Illness Prevention Programs.
Ensures the department meets all legal and regulatory compliance requirements.
Establishes assessment systems and monitors activities to ensure compliance with established procedures.
Works to address the needs of customers and develops comprehensive solutions/offerings that address complex needs across all customer segments.
Delivers on Budget, on Plan, and on Purpose the Capital Budget, Expense Budget, Unit Costs, Labor Costs, Overtime, Project Schedule Milestones, Complete Critical Projects, and Complete Maintenance Plans.
Ensures and ongoing state of readiness and effective plans for emergency response for significant situations and system-wide electrical events.
Represents the company in contacts with other utilities, various industry boards, committees, regulatory agencies, governmental bodies, and other private organizations.
Collaborates with others to identify, analyze, and improve existing business processes within a department to meet new goals and objectives.
Plans for and coordinates process improvement activities to ensure consistency, cohesiveness and sharing of best practices.
Leads the responding and resolving field troubleshooting requests.
Ensures maintenance and construction work in assigned area is completed on time, within budget and quality expectations while adhering to safety and regulatory compliance.
Requirements
High School Diploma or GED
Seven (7) years of related experience in electric utility maintenance, construction, or operations
Three (3) years’ supervisory experience
Cluster-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ering, Construction Management or job-related discipline or equivalent experience (Desired)
Leadership experience, electric construction (Desired)
